Raleigh

Raleigh is the capital city of the state of North Carolina. The city has a population of about 450,000 and is home to many colleges and university including North Carolina State University, Shaw University, Saint Augustine's College, Meredith College and Peace University. The city has a wide range of museums, restaurants, theaters, and parks. There's also an extensive greenway system that is great for biking or running.

Vieques Island

Amidst the melodious chorus of coqui frogs and gentle whispers of palm trees blowing in an evening breeze, you will find that the waters around you glow just as brightly as the stars above. This tropical paradise is none other than Vieques, Puerto Rico. Tropical forests, bioluminescent bays, coral reefs--this island attracts visitors from all around the world who seek to see the wonders and beauties of the tropics. This island suits those from all walks of life, from history buffs seeking to learn about its unique past to nature-lovers wanting to admire its untouched wilderness. Which place is cheaper, Vieques Island or Raleigh?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Raleigh is $189, while the average daily cost in Vieques Island is $170.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When is the best time to visit Raleigh or Vieques Island?

Raleigh has a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, but Vieques Island experiences a warm climate with fairly sunny weather most of the year.

Should I visit Raleigh or Vieques Island in the Summer?

Both Vieques Island and Raleigh during the summer are popular places to visit. Many visitors come to Raleigh in the summer for the city activities and the family-friendly experiences. Warm weather and sunshine bring visitors to Vieques Island year-round.

In July, Raleigh is generally around the same temperature as Vieques Island. Daily temperatures in Raleigh average around 79°F (26°C), and Vieques Island fluctuates around 29°C (83°F).

In Vieques Island, it's very sunny this time of the year. It's quite sunny in Raleigh. In the summer, Raleigh often gets less sunshine than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 259 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Vieques Island receives 287 hours of full sun.

It rains a lot this time of the year in Raleigh. Raleigh usually gets more rain in July than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 5.1 inches (129 mm) of rain, while Vieques Island receives 66 mm (2.6 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Raleigh or Vieques Island in the Autumn?

The autumn attracts plenty of travelers to both Raleigh and Vieques Island. Most visitors come to Raleigh for the city's sights and attractions during these months. Vieques Island attracts visitors year-round for its warm weather and sunny climate.

Raleigh is much colder than Vieques Island in the autumn. The daily temperature in Raleigh averages around 61°F (16°C) in October, and Vieques Island fluctuates around 28°C (82°F).

People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Vieques Island this time of the year. In Raleigh, it's very sunny this time of the year. Raleigh usually receives less sunshine than Vieques Island during autumn. Raleigh gets 211 hours of sunny skies, while Vieques Island receives 235 hours of full sun in the autumn.

Vieques Island receives a lot of rain in the autumn. In October, Raleigh usually receives less rain than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 2.8 inches (71 mm) of rain, while Vieques Island receives 146 mm (5.7 in) of rain each month for the autumn.

Should I visit Raleigh or Vieques Island in the Winter?

The winter brings many poeple to Raleigh as well as Vieques Island. The winter months attract visitors to Raleigh because of the museums and the cuisine. The warm climate attracts visitors to Vieques Island throughout the year.

The weather in Raleigh can be very cold. In the winter, Raleigh is much colder than Vieques Island. Typically, the winter temperatures in Raleigh in January average around 40°F (5°C), and Vieques Island averages at about 26°C (78°F).

The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Vieques Island. In the winter, Raleigh often gets less sunshine than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 162 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Vieques Island receives 240 hours of full sun.

Raleigh usually gets more rain in January than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 3.2 inches (82 mm) of rain, while Vieques Island receives 43 mm (1.7 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Raleigh or Vieques Island in the Spring?

Both Vieques Island and Raleigh are popular destinations to visit in the spring with plenty of activities. The activities around the city are the main draw to Raleigh this time of year. Plenty of visitors come to Vieques Island because of the warm climate and sunshine that lasts throughout the year.

In April, Raleigh is generally much colder than Vieques Island. Daily temperatures in Raleigh average around 60°F (16°C), and Vieques Island fluctuates around 27°C (80°F).

It's quite sunny in Vieques Island. The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Raleigh. Raleigh usually receives less sunshine than Vieques Island during spring. Raleigh gets 251 hours of sunny skies, while Vieques Island receives 272 hours of full sun in the spring.

In April, Raleigh usually receives more rain than Vieques Island. Raleigh gets 3.1 inches (78 mm) of rain, while Vieques Island receives 72 mm (2.8 in) of rain each month for the spring.

Typical Weather for Vieques Island and Raleigh

Raleigh Vieques Island
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 40°F (5°C) 3.2 inches (82 mm) 26°C (78°F) 43 mm (1.7 in)
Feb 43°F (6°C) 3.3 inches (84 mm) 26°C (78°F) 39 mm (1.5 in)
Mar 52°F (11°C) 3.4 inches (87 mm) 26°C (79°F) 49 mm (1.9 in)
Apr 60°F (16°C) 3.1 inches (78 mm) 27°C (80°F) 72 mm (2.8 in)
May 68°F (20°C) 3.3 inches (84 mm) 28°C (82°F) 94 mm (3.7 in)
Jun 76°F (24°C) 3.7 inches (93 mm) 28°C (83°F) 64 mm (2.5 in)
Jul 79°F (26°C) 5.1 inches (129 mm) 29°C (83°F) 66 mm (2.6 in)
Aug 78°F (26°C) 4.9 inches (125 mm) 29°C (84°F) 101 mm (4 in)
Sep 73°F (23°C) 3.8 inches (96 mm) 28°C (83°F) 127 mm (5 in)
Oct 61°F (16°C) 2.8 inches (71 mm) 28°C (82°F) 146 mm (5.7 in)
Nov 53°F (11°C) 2.8 inches (72 mm) 27°C (81°F) 126 mm (4.9 in)
Dec 44°F (7°C) 3.1 inches (78 mm) 26°C (80°F) 71 mm (2.8 in)
